Planet Earth Episode 7: "Great Plains"MKV | 832 x 544 |AC3 | 732MB This episode deals with savanna, steppe, tundra, prairie, and looks at the importance and resilience of grasses in such treeless ecosystems. Their vast expanses contain the largest concentration of animal life. In Outer Mongolia, a herd of Mongolian gazelle flee a bush fire and has to move on to new grazing, but grass can repair itself rapidly and soon reappears. On the Arctic tundra during spring, millions of migratory snow geese arrive to breed and their young are preyed on by Arctic foxes. Meanwhile, time-lapse photography depicts moving herds of caribou as a calf is brought down by a chasing wolf. On the North American prairie, bison engage in the ritual to establish the dominant males. The Tibetan Plateau is the highest of the plains and despite its relative lack of grass, animals do survive there, including yak and wild ass. However, the area's most numerous resident is the pika, whose nemesis is the Tibetan fox. In tropical India, the tall grasses hide some of the largest creatures and also the smallest, such as the pygmy hog. The final sequence depicts the African savannah and elephants that are forced to share a waterhole with a pride of thirty lions. The insufficient water makes it an uneasy alliance and the latter gain the upper hand during the night when their hunger drives them to hunt and eventually kill one of the pachyderms. Planet Earth Diaries explains how the lion hunt was filmed in darkness using infrared light. |

The Adventures of Huckleberry Finn by Mark Twain The Adventures of Huckleberry Finn by Mark TwainPublisher: CreateSpace 2003 | 202 Pages | ISBN: 1438245416 | PDF | 1.3 MB A seminal work of American Literature that still commands deep praise and still elicits controversy, Adventures of Huckleberry Finn is essential to the understanding of the American soul. The recent discovery of the first half of Twain's manuscript, long thought lost, made front-page news. And this unprecedented edition, which contains for the first time omitted e pisodes and other variations present in the first half of the handwritten manuscript, as well as facsimile reproductions of thirty manuscript pages, is indispensable to a full understanding of the novel. The changes, deletions, and additions made in the first half of the manuscript indicate that Mark Twain frequently checked his impulse to write an even darker, more confrontational book than the one he finally published. |

A chronicle of the heavy metal band Pantera's 1992 tour, behind the "Vulgar Display of Power" album, that chronicles all of the band's excesses with groupies, drinking and drugs. Also featured in the video are members of White Zombie, Megadeth and Metallica This collection of 3 Pantera home video releases -- WATCH IT GO, COWBOYS FROM HELL, and VULGAR VIDEOS -- spans over four hours and gives as in-depth a look at the hard, hard rock band as any fan could hope for. In addition to featuring several short-form music videos for songs like "Cowboys From Hell" and "I'm Broken," this collection also contains live footage (most notably from the Monsters of Rock concert in Moscow,) exclusive band interviews, and rare, extremely personal footage of Phil Anselmo and the boys on the road. Publisher: Ziff Davis Media Language: English Number of Pages: 100 PDF: 25 MB Electronic Gaming Monthly (often abbreviated to EGM) is an American video game magazine. It is published by Ziff-Davis as part of the 1UP Network and releases 12 issues a year (and an occasional extra "13th" issue for the Christmas season, also known as the "Smarch" issue, a reference to an e pisode of The Simpsons). EGM concentrates on news regarding current video game consoles (see magazine content for detailed information). The December 2006 issue introduces new sections, expanded reviews, and focuses more on the acronym of the magazine's title in a redesign. This is the first issue redesign since June 2003. EGM has said that the reason for the design shift is to keep more in line with the site layout of their website, 1up.com. EGM also spawned EGM2 in 1994, which focused on expanded cheats and tricks (i.e. with maps and guides) which eventually became Expert Gamer, and then to its final moniker, the defunct GameNOW. |
